Mahabharata Drona Parva – ऊतमौजा हताश्वस तु हतसूतश च संयुगे

Shloka (श्लोक)

ऊतमौजा हताश्वस तु हतसूतश च संयुगे
आरुरॊह रथं भरातुर युधामन्यॊर अभित्वरन

⚡ Quick Meaning

Utamaouja, having lost his horses, ascended the chariot in great urgency.

Translations

English Translation

In this verse, Utamaouja, realizing the peril he is in after losing his horses in battle, swiftly climbs onto the chariot to continue fighting. This illustrates the urgency and desperation faced by warriors in the midst of conflict, showcasing their determination to fight against the odds.

हिंदी अनुवाद

इस श्लोक में, ऊतमौजा, जो युद्ध में अपने घोड़ों को खो चुका है, जल्दी से रथ पर चढ़ता है। यह युद्ध के दौरान योद्धाओं द्वारा महसूस की गई तात्कालिकता और हताशा को दर्शाता है, जो विपरीत स्थितियों में भी लड़ने की उनकी इच्छाशक्ति को प्रकट करता है।
